What is part time health insurance?

Part time health insurance refers to health coverage options available to employees who work fewer hours than full-time staff, typically less than 30-35 hours per week. Some employers offer health insurance benefits to part-time workers, but eligibility and coverage can vary widely. If employer-sponsored insurance isn't available, part-time employees may seek coverage through the Health Insurance Marketplace or other private plans. It's important to compare options to find a plan that fits your medical needs and budget.

What are some common challenges faced by part-time employees when enrolling in health insurance benefits?

Part-time employees often encounter challenges such as limited eligibility for employer-sponsored health insurance, fewer plan options, or higher premiums compared to full-time staff. Additionally, navigating the enrollment process may require extra research to understand available public or private plans if employer coverage is not offered. It's important for part-time workers to carefully review hours-worked requirements and consult HR or benefits coordinators to ensure they don't miss critical enrollment deadlines or potential subsidies.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a Part-Time Health Insurance Agent,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Part-Time Health Insurance Agent, you need a solid understanding of health insurance products, state licensing, and sales fundamentals. Familiarity with CRM software, quoting platforms, and industry certification (such as a state health insurance license) is typically required. Exceptional interpersonal skills, active listening, and the ability to explain complex information clearly make agents stand out. These skills are crucial for building trust, meeting clients’ needs, and maintaining compliance in a highly regulated and client-focused industry.

Job description

Job Summary:
We are seeking a detail-oriented Part-Time Health Benefits Specialist to assist employees with health benefits and benefits-related inquiries. The ideal candidate will provide health benefit information to employees and explain benefit plans, process enrollments.

Key Responsibilities:

  • Assist individuals with questions regarding health insurance plans, eligibility, and coverage.
  • Process benefit enrollments, changes, and terminations accurately and in a timely manner.
  • Explain medical, dental, vision, prescription, and other employee benefit programs.
  • Verify eligibility and maintain accurate benefit records.
  • Educate employees on available health benefit options during open enrollment and qualifying life events.
  • Maintain confidentiality of sensitive personal and health information in accordance with HIPAA guidelines.
  • Respond to phone calls, emails, and in-person inquiries professionally and promptly.
  • Stay current on healthcare regulations, insurance policies, and company benefit offerings.
  • Perform other administrative duties as assigned.

Qualifications:

  • High school diploma or GED required; associate's or bachelor's degree preferred.
  • Previous experience in health insurance, employee benefits, human resources preferred.
  • Knowledge of health insurance terminology and benefit plans.
  • Familiarity with HIPAA and healthcare compliance requirements.
  • Strong communication, organizational, and problem-solving skills.
  • Proficiency with Microsoft Office and benefits administration software.
  • Ability to work independently and manage multiple tasks.

Preferred Skills:

  • Excellent interpersonal skills.
  • Strong attention to detail and accuracy.
  • Ability to explain complex benefit information in a clear, understandable manner.
  • Time management and organizational skills.
  • Bilingual skills are a plus.

Schedule:

  • Part-time (4 hours a day/ 3 times a week)
  • Flexible schedule
